How could I make GDM start at boot? I looked through Google, and the only result that I got was Code: | rc-update add gdm default | and that didn't work. |

First, edit /etc/rc.conf and replace
Code: | DISPLAYMANAGER="xdm" |
with
Code: | DISPLAYMANAGER="gdm" |
Then run
Code: | rc-update add xdm default |
